Low Testosterone and Its Impacts
Low testosterone, often referred to as Low T, can affect men of varying ages, with symptoms including decreased libido, fatigue, depression, and erectile dysfunction. The impact of low testosterone on overall well-being cannot be understated, as it can disrupt personal relationships and significantly diminish one’s quality of life. Exploring Extracorporeal Shock Wave Therapy (ESWT)
Extracorporeal Shock Wave Therapy, commonly known as ESWT, has emerged as a non-invasive treatment option for individuals dealing with erectile dysfunction. This therapy involves the use of low-intensity shock waves to improve blood flow to the penis, ultimately enhancing erectile function. While ESWT shows promise in addressing this aspect of male sexual health, it’s essential for men to explore the effectiveness, potential side effects, and long-term benefits of this treatment before making a decision.
